A Victorian Scottish silver Prize for Cheese.
£325.00
A Victorian Scottish silver Medal for Chedder Cheese, the ‘New Cumnock Cheese Show’, 1861. Struck with a maker’s mark only for Peter McFarlane of Glasgow.

Description
Condition:
Good with some edge knocks and minor marking to surface.
Dimensions:
Height – 6.50cm.; Width – 5.90cm.; Depth – 0.50cm.; Weight – 37.30 gms.
